Christine Young is a scholar working on Electronic, Optical and Magnetic Materials, Electrical and Electronic Engineering and Materials Chemistry. According to data from OpenAlex, Christine Young has authored 35 papers receiving a total of 2.8k ind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Electronic, Optical and Magnetic Materials, 22 papers in Electrical and Electronic Engineering and 12 papers in Materials Chemistry. Recurrent topics in Christine Young’s work include Supercapacitor Materials and Fabrication (28 papers), Advancements in Battery Materials (16 papers) and Metal-Organic Frameworks: Synthesis and Applications (9 papers). Christine Young is often cited by papers focused on Supercapacitor Materials and Fabrication (28 papers), Advancements in Battery Materials (16 papers) and Metal-Organic Frameworks: Synthesis and Applications (9 papers). Christine Young collaborates with scholars based in Japan, Australia and Taiwan. Christine Young's co-authors include Yusuke Yamauchi, Jeonghun Kim, Rahul R. Salunkhe, Jing Tang, Yusuf Valentino Kaneti, Yoshiyuki Sugahara, Md. Shahriar A. Hossain, Jie Wang, Joel Henzie and Jung Ho Kim and has published in prestigious journals such as PLoS ONE, Chemistry of Materials and Chemical Communications.
